Developed by the National Treasury, the Central Bank of Kenya (CBK), and the Capital Markets Authority (CMA), the system aims to reduce fraud, increase transparency, and establish formal financial controls over digital assets. The strategy combines encouraging innovation with precautionary measures similar to those used in traditional banking.\u003C\u002Fp>\u003Cp>The VASP Law legally defines virtual assets and obliges all service providers, including exchanges, wallet operators, and trading platforms, to be licensed to operate in Kenya. This licensing acts as the most important means of protecting consumer rights. Applicants must provide detailed business plans, reliable cybersecurity systems, and anti-money laundering (AML) tools. Regulators are also authorized to conduct compliance checks on directors and senior management in order to prevent non-transparent players from entering the market.\u003C\u002Fp>\u003Cp>The central element of this system is compliance with AML and «Know Your Customer» (KYC) rules, consistent with the standards of the Global Financial Action Task Force (FATF). Companies should verify user identities, monitor transactions, and report suspicious activity to the Financial Reporting Center. Although these measures reduce risks such as account hijacking fraud and unauthorized transfers, they do not eliminate all types of fraud, especially those related to social engineering.\u003C\u002Fp>\u003Cp>Kenya has established a structure with two regulatory bodies: the CBK oversees digital assets that function as payment instruments or stablecoins, while the CMA oversees investment-related products and exchanges. This division aims to address regulatory gaps and provide users with clearer ways to resolve disputes.\u003C\u002Fp>\u003Cp>The draft rules of 2026 also introduce capital adequacy and reserve requirements. For example, stablecoin issuers may be required to keep customer funds in separate bank accounts in Kenya, and invest the remainder in local low-risk assets. This structure is designed to prevent the collapse of liquidity and reduce exposure to offshore risks. In addition, licensed providers must maintain high standards of operational resilience, including data protection and system redundancy, to protect against cyber attacks.\u003C\u002Fp>\u003Cp>Mandatory reporting, including financial disclosure and audit reports, will introduce market discipline, which will allow regulators to identify early signs of insolvency. Although this compliance-based approach is aimed at turning cryptocurrencies into a controlled financial segment, industry feedback suggests that high compliance costs can consolidate the market among higher-cap players.\u003C\u002Fp>\u003Cp>As Kenya moves towards finalizing the 2026 rules, the goal is clear: to replace the speculative, lightly regulated environment with a mainstream financial system in which user protection is provided structurally. Recent engagement with the industry, including discussions between exchanges such as Binance and the Kenyan Anti-Money Laundering Association, reflects a growing commitment to this transparent, regulated future.\u003C\u002Fp>",{"title":85,"value":86},"Align Left","left",[88,91,95],{"id":69,"title":89,"alias":90,"is_current":11},"Republic of Kenya","republic-of-kenya",{"id":92,"title":93,"alias":94,"is_current":11},13,"Economy","economy",{"id":96,"title":97,"alias":98,"is_current":11},20,"Legislation","legislation",[],[101],{"id":13,"title":14,"fullTitle":15,"description":16,"icon":8,"alias":17,"color":18,"isShowOnMainPage":11,"isShowOnTopMenu":11},[103],{"id":26,"title":38,"alias":39},[],{"id":106,"title":107,"slug":108},28,"Saving the Bugoma Forest in Uganda","saving-the-bugoma-forest-in-uganda",true,890,[112,137,162,184,207,227],{"id":113,"title":114,"alias":115,"description":116,"publishedAt":117,"previewImage":118,"views":119,"tags":120,"categories":133,"countryCategories":135,"relatedPosts":-1},82,"The impact of the US-Iran agreement on fuel prices in East Africa","the-impact-of-the-us-iran-agreement-on-fuel-prices-in-east-africa","\u003Cp>The recent peace agreement between the United States and Iran has brought a new wave of optimism to global oil markets, which will directly affect the cost of fuel in Kenya.
